Clarius Group LLC Sells 2,311 Shares of Wells Fargo & Company $WFC

Clarius Group LLC decreased its holdings in Wells Fargo & Company (NYSE:WFC) by 12.2% during the 2nd qu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The institutional investor owned 16,566 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after selling 2,311 shares during the quarter. Clarius Group LLC’s holdings in Wells Fargo & Company were worth $1,327,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ission.

Wells Fargo & Company Trading Up 0.2%

Shares of NYSE:WFC opened at $80.63 on Friday. The company has a market capitalization of $258.28 billion, a P/E ratio of 13.81, a P/E/G ratio of 1.24 and a beta of 1.25. Wells Fargo & Company has a 1 year low of $55.98 and a 1 year high of $86.65.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.06, a current ratio of 0.84 and a quick ratio of 0.83. The business’s 50 day simple moving average is $80.77 and its 200 day simple moving average is $76.31.

Wells Fargo & Company (NYSE:WFCG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, July 15th. The financial services provider reported $1.54 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.41 by $0.13. The business had revenue of $20.82 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$20.83 billion. Wells Fargo & Company had a return on equity of 12.29% and a net margin of 16.82%.The firm’s quarterly revenue was up .6%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ted $1.33 earnings per share. On average, research analysts anticipate that Wells Fargo & Company will post 5.89 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Wells Fargo & Company Increases Dividend

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, September 1st. Investors of record on Friday, August 8th were given a dividend of $0.45 per share. This is an increase from Wells Fargo & Company’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.40. This represents a $1.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.2%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, August 8th. Wells Fargo & Company’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 30.82%.

About Wells Fargo & Company

(Free Report)

Wells Fargo & Co is a diversified and community-based financial services company, which engages in the provision of banking, insurance, investments, mortgage, and consumer and commercial finance products and services. It operates through the following segments: Consumer Banking and Lending, Commercial Banking, Corporate and Investment Banking, and Wealth and Investment Management.
